+I am surprised nothing like this exists already, so am all for the idea.
+
+Maybe I am misunderstanding, but I'm not sure you want to have
+thousand separators and other locale stuff in there. All currencies
+including USD are often shown in Swedish using space or dot as
+thousand separator and comma as decimal separator, e.g. "1.234,56 USD"
+or "1 234,56 USD". I.e. this is something that the locale of the
+user's environment defines, not something the server should have
+opinions about. It is also not ideal to propose a given format based
+on the user's locale, as some users have preferences for this (I
+personally use US locale for numbers, and a US person who is visiting
+Sweden wouldn't want this to suddenly change).
+
+-Kalle.

+On Sat, Mar 4, 2017 at 12:27 AM, Luke Dashjr via bitcoin-dev
+<bitcoin-dev@lists.linuxfoundation.org> wrote:
+> Investigating what it would take to add fiat currency information to Bitcoin
+> Knots, I noticed Electrum currently has many implementations, one for each
+> exchange rate provider, due to lack of a common format for such data.
+>
+> Therefore, I put together an initial draft of a BIP that could standardise
+> this so wallets (or other software) and exchange rate providers can simply
+> interoperate without a lot of overhead reimplementing the same thing many
+> ways.
+>
+> One thing I am unsure about, is that currently this draft requires using XBT
+> (as BTC) for Bitcoin amounts. It would seem nicer to use satoshis, but those
+> don't really have a pseudo-ISO currency code to fit in nicely...
+>
+> Current draft here:
+> https://github.com/luke-jr/bips/blob/bip-xchgrate/bip-xchgrate.mediawiki
+>
+> Thoughts? Anything critical missing? Ways to make the interface better?
+>
+> Luke
